Why Does IPTV Buffer Even on Fast Internet Connections?
Many users assume buffering means their internet connection is too slow. In reality, IPTV performance depends on several factors.
Common causes include:
- ISP throttling
- Congested VPN servers
- Overloaded IPTV provider servers
- Poor routing between networks
- Device hardware limitations
- Wi-Fi interference
For example, a 100 Mbps connection can still experience buffering if your ISP prioritizes other traffic over video streams during busy periods.
How ISP Throttling Affects IPTV
ISPs manage network traffic using techniques commonly called traffic shaping or bandwidth management.
When large amounts of streaming traffic are detected, some providers may reduce speeds for specific traffic categories during congestion periods.
This is especially noticeable during:
- Live sports broadcasts
- Prime-time television hours
- Large pay-per-view events
- Major international sporting tournaments
The result is increased buffering despite having sufficient bandwidth on paper.
Why IPTV Is More Sensitive Than Netflix
Netflix, YouTube, and similar services use massive content delivery networks (CDNs) with servers distributed across the country.
Many IPTV services do not have this infrastructure.
As a result:
- Latency matters more
- Packet loss becomes more noticeable
- Routing inefficiencies create buffering faster
- ISP traffic management has greater impact
A VPN cannot fix a poorly operated IPTV service, but it can often improve routing quality and prevent traffic identification.
How Does a VPN Stop ISP Throttling on IPTV Streams?
The biggest benefit of a VPN for IPTV is encryption.
Once connected to a VPN server:
- Your ISP can see you’re using a VPN
- Your ISP cannot easily determine which specific service you’re streaming
- Traffic becomes encrypted inside a secure tunnel
- Traffic classification becomes more difficult

When Can a VPN Make IPTV Performance Worse?
Many VPN reviews imply that a VPN automatically improves streaming performance. Reality is more complicated.
A VPN can reduce buffering when ISP throttling is the problem. However, it can also introduce new bottlenecks if you choose the wrong provider, server, or configuration.
Understanding these limitations helps you troubleshoot IPTV performance more effectively.
Connecting to Distant Servers
One of the most common mistakes is selecting a server thousands of miles away.
For example:
- New York user → New York VPN server = low latency
- New York user → Singapore VPN server = significantly higher latency
Long-distance routing increases:
- Ping times
- Packet travel distance
- Network complexity
For IPTV, this often translates into slower channel loading and occasional buffering.

Why Do Hardware Limitations Matter for IPTV?
This is one of the biggest content gaps across competing IPTV VPN guides.
Many articles assume buffering is always caused by the internet connection. In practice, device hardware can be equally important.
Older Fire TV Devices
Entry-level Firesticks often have:
- Limited RAM
- Older processors
- Reduced storage capacity
Running simultaneously:
- IPTV app
- VPN app
- Background system processes
can push older hardware to its limits.
The result may look like network buffering even when your connection is performing well.
Android TV Boxes
The Android TV market includes everything from premium hardware to very inexpensive generic devices.
Low-end boxes frequently suffer from:
- Weak processors
- Thermal throttling
- Poor Wi-Fi chips
- Outdated software
Adding VPN encryption increases processing requirements, which can expose these hardware weaknesses.
Router Performance
Router-based VPN installation offers convenience but introduces another consideration.
Encryption consumes CPU resources.
Older routers may struggle with:
- WireGuard
- OpenVPN
- High-bitrate 4K streams
This can create a bottleneck regardless of internet speed.
Users with gigabit internet sometimes discover that an aging router limits VPN throughput to a fraction of their available bandwidth.

What Privacy Risks Do Many IPTV Users Overlook?
Speed receives most of the attention, but privacy configuration matters too.
Even a fast VPN can expose information if critical protections are missing.
DNS Leaks
A DNS leak occurs when domain requests bypass the VPN tunnel.
Potential consequences include:
- Activity exposure to your ISP
- Reduced privacy
- Incomplete traffic protection
Premium providers include built-in DNS leak prevention to address this issue.
IPv6 Leaks
Many networks now support IPv6.
If VPN software handles IPv6 incorrectly, some traffic may bypass the encrypted tunnel.
Quality VPN providers address this through:
- IPv6 leak protection
- Secure routing controls
- Automatic leak prevention
Kill Switch Protection
A kill switch disconnects internet access if the VPN unexpectedly drops.
Without a kill switch:
- Traffic may revert to the normal connection
- Streaming activity becomes visible again
- Privacy protections disappear temporarily
For IPTV users who prioritize privacy, a kill switch should remain enabled at all times.

How Can You Maximize IPTV Performance With a VPN?
Even the best VPN performs better when configured correctly.
Use Nearby Servers
For most IPTV users, the fastest server is usually:
- In the same state
- In a neighboring state
- In the nearest major city
Avoid distant locations unless necessary.
Use WireGuard-Based Protocols
Whenever available, prioritize:
- WireGuard
- NordLynx
- Lightway
These protocols generally provide better speed than older OpenVPN configurations.
Connect Through Ethernet When Possible
Wi-Fi introduces variables that VPNs cannot control.
A wired connection often reduces:
- Packet loss
- Interference
- Random buffering events
This becomes especially important for 4K IPTV streams.
Restart Devices Periodically
Streaming devices accumulate:
- Cached files
- Background processes
- Memory usage
A periodic restart can improve overall responsiveness.

What Internet Speed Is Needed for IPTV?
General recommendations:
- SD streaming: 5 Mbps
- HD streaming: 10–15 Mbps
- Full HD streaming: 20 Mbps
- 4K streaming: 25 Mbps or higher
Actual requirements vary depending on the IPTV provider.
